Analysis of social capital affecting participation in rangeland restoration projects (Kurdistan province, Qorveh city)

Abstract

Nowadays participation will fail without the support of social capital. The weakness of social capital in rural communities due to lack of participation in social activities. The aim of this study was to evaluate the role of social capital and its components in the desire to participate in rangelands rehabilitation and restoration projects in the city is Qorveh. The purpose of this research, applied research method, path analysis - correlation. The population of 600 ranchers and farmers were Qorveh city. The sample in this study, 234 patients were selected according to Morgan table. Data were collected by questionnaire. To ensure the validity of the experts and Cronbach's alpha coefficient was used to calculate reliability and value higher than 0.7, respectively. To examine the relationship between participation and indicators of a sense of belonging, social participation, security and social capital of the Pearson correlation coefficient (according to its normal distribution) and to examine the relationship between participation tend to trust people, trust institutional and social cohesion of the Spearman correlation coefficient was used. The results showed that social capital is able to account for 62% of the total variance of the willingness of farmers to participate in rangelands rehabilitation and restoration plans were. Also, results from the effects of path analysis showed that the variables of social participation, institutional trust, interpersonal trust, sense of belonging and social cohesion; the highest impact on participation of farmers and farmers in their rangelands rehabilitation and restoration projects.
